The cleaning treatment system and treatment process of a kind of waste water-base drilling mud
Technical field
The present invention relates to a kind of mud disposal system and techniques, and in particular at a kind of cleaning of waste water-base drilling mud Reason system and treatment process, belong to field of Environment Protection.
Background technology
The processing mode of waste water-base drilling mud mainly has does not land processing mode with two kinds of brill and central treating station, is It realizes the minimizing target of drilling mud processing, is handled with brill and generally employ technique that is de- steady and carrying out filter-press dehydration.So And due to the difference of different drilling depths, different work areas slip, individual mud takes off steady and filter-press dehydration technique can not Ensure that the leachate of solid phase mud cake meets relevant environmental requirement, therefore, processing up to standard is carried out to solid phase mud cake needs addition solid Chemical drug agent is to realize environmentally friendly purpose.Although the method can realize processing up to standard, need curing medicament to be added more, processing It is costly.And central treating station generally realizes the processing of mud using the direct technique for carrying out solidification and stabilization, but handle The addition for curing medicament in the process is up to 20-40%, and causing that treated, solid phase total amount dramatically increases, cause subsequent transportation and Comprehensively utilize the increase of burden.Therefore, a kind of effective processing that can realize waste water-base drilling mud is developed, and can be to avoid solid The processing system being significantly increased and technique of phase total amount are the technical issues of those skilled in the art are urgently to be resolved hurrily.

Specific embodiment
The specific embodiment of the present invention is described further below in conjunction with the accompanying drawings.
As shown in Figure 1, a kind of according to an aspect of the invention, there is provided cleaning treatment system of waste water-base drilling mud System, the mud including being sequentially connected setting by pipeline take off steady unit, slurry dewatering unit and cleaning and dewatering unit, In, the mud, which takes off steady unit, to be included taking off steady tank, and described take off in steady tank has added de- steady medicament.Further, by weight hundred Divide than meter, the de- steady medicament includes:Aluminium polychloride or aluminum sulfate:5-20%, polyaluminum ferric chloride (PAFC):5-20%, High polymer polyacrylamide (molecular weight 300-2000 ten thousand):0-0.5%, highly basic:0-5% and lime:54.5-90%.It is described Slurry dewatering unit includes plate and frame filter press, to be carried out dehydrating to the mud after mud takes off steady unit destablizing, takes off The solid phase that water generates enters cleaning and dewatering unit.In the present invention, the cleaning and dewatering unit includes purge tank and solid-liquid point Being added in from equipment, in the purge tank has cleaning solution and cleaning agent, and by weight percentage, the cleaning agent is by 20- 90% cement, 5-40% aluminum sulfate, 3-30% aluminium polychlorides and 0-10% acid compositions;The solid-liquid separating equipment can be The solid-liquid separating equipments such as plate and frame filter press, centrifugal dehydration and folded spiral shell squeezer.In the present invention, the cleaning and dewatering unit can Be provided with it is at least one, with to slurry dewatering unit through dehydration generate solid phase carry out that dehydration, processing procedure is cleaned multiple times In, the solid phase that upper cleaning and dewatering cell processing generates is into next cleaning and dewatering unit, and next cleaning and dewatering unit generates Liquid phase a cleaning and dewatering unit can be back to as cleaning solution, until the solid phase that generates and liquid after cleaned dehydration Mutually meet corresponding examination criteria.Particularly, in the present invention, the cleaning and dewatering unit may be provided with 1-10.In addition, this The invention cleaning treatment system may also include water treatment unit, and the water treatment unit includes purifier, the water purification Equipment may include at least one in the purifiers commonly used in the art such as air supporting sedimentation device, electric flocculation device and oxidation unit Kind, purified treatment is carried out with the liquid phase generated to slurry dewatering unit, the production water for handling generation can be used for drilling team and station reuse Or directly discharge, also it can be back to cleaning and dewatering unit as cleaning solution.
According to another aspect of the present invention, additionally provide it is a kind of using processing system as described above to drilling mud carry out The cleaning of cleaning, comprises the following steps:
1) mud destablizing:Storage or transport extremely collect after the received device of pending waste water-base drilling mud is collected Middle station is stored in de- steady tank, and takes off steady medicament to mud progress destablizing to taking off to add in steady tank;
Wherein, by weight percentage, the de- steady medicament includes:Aluminium polychloride or aluminum sulfate:5-20%, polymerization chlorine Change ferro-aluminum (PAFC):5-20%, high polymer polyacrylamide (molecular weight 300-2000 ten thousand):0-0.5%, highly basic:0-5%, with And lime:54.5-90%;Wherein, the highly basic is sodium hydroxide and/or potassium hydroxide, and by pending mud gauge, institute The addition for stating de- steady medicament is 0.5-10wt%;
2) slurry dewatering is handled:Mud in step 1) after destablizing is lifted into slurry dewatering unit through pump It is carried out dehydrating in plate and frame filter press;
3) cleaning and dewatering is handled:The solid phase generated in step 2) through dehydration enters the purge tank of cleaning and dewatering unit In start the cleaning processing 0.1-4 it is small when, and the mud mixture after cleaning is carried out dehydrating using solid-liquid separating equipment;
Wherein, being added in the cleaning process has cleaning solution, and the cleaning solution can be clear water, and by solid phase to be cleaned Weight meter, the cleaning solution added in:The weight ratio of solid phase is 1:1-25:1;Cleaning agent can be also added in cleaning process, by weight Percentages are measured, the cleaning agent is by 20-90% cement, 5-40% aluminum sulfate, 3-30% aluminium polychlorides and 0-10% Acid composition, further, the acid are at least one of sulfuric acid, hydrochloric acid, phosphoric acid and nitric acid, and its addition is to be cleaned Solid phase weight 0-30%.
In addition, the cleaning of the present invention may also include step 4) clean water treatment:Using purifier to the mud of step 2) The liquid phase generated in slurry dehydration process steps carries out clean water treatment, and the production water for handling generation can be used for drilling team and station reuse or straight Run in and put, can be also back to as cleaning solution in cleaning and dewatering processing step.
As shown in Figure 1, in the present invention, according to actual conditions, the cleaning and dewatering processing in step 3) can carry out N successively It is secondary, i.e. after carrying out once cleaning and dehydration to the solid phase generated in step 2) through dehydration, then it is de- to once cleaning The solid phase that water process generates carries out secondary cleaning dehydration, and so on, until final cleaned dehydration generation is consolidated Reuse standard mutually can be met.Further, in the present invention, 1≤N≤10, also, produced by the processing of a rear cleaning and dewatering Liquid phase the processing of last cleaning and dewatering can be back to as cleaning solution;Specifically:If N=1, clear water can be used in cleaning solution And/or the production water in step 4) clean water treatment step;As 1 < N≤10, then clear water and/or step can be used in the cleaning solution of n-th Production water in rapid 4) clean water treatment step, and clear water and/or the processing of n-th cleaning and dewatering then can be used in the cleaning solution of the N-1 times The liquid phase generated in clear water and/or the N-1 times cleaning and dewatering processing then can be used in the liquid phase of middle generation, the cleaning solution of the N-2 times, And so on, until the solid phase leachate that cleaned dehydration generates meets reuse standard, to be back to brickmaking, pave the way. And the liquid phase that first time cleaning and dewatering generates can enter water treatment unit and carry out clean water treatment.
Embodiment 1
The waste water-base drilling mud generated using processing system as described above of the invention and treatment process to certain well site It is handled, wherein, in mud destablizing step, the weight percent composition for taking off steady medicament is:Aluminum sulfate 15%, polymerization chlorine Change ferro-aluminum 20%, polyacrylamide (molecular weight 10,000,000) 0.5%, sodium hydroxide 2%, lime 62.5%;And by pending Mud gauge, the addition for taking off steady medicament is 5%;Xun Huan carries out 2 times altogether for the cleaning and dewatering processing, and cleans each time In dehydration, the cleaning solution and the weight ratio of pending solid phase that are added in are 15:1;The weight of the cleaning agent added in Percentage composition is 75% cement, 15% aluminum sulfate, 6% aluminium polychloride and 4% nitric acid form, and its addition is to wait to locate Manage the 10% of solid phase weight.Its handling result is as shown in table 1:
1 drilling mud handling result of table
According to the handling result of table 1, handled by the two level cleaning and dewatering of the present invention, realize waste water-base drilling well The innoxious processing up to standard of mud solid phase, solid phase weight reduce 23% before relatively cleaning, can either realize the requirement of environment protection standard, There is the clear superiority of drilling cuttings solid phase minimizing processing again, realize the comprehensive utilization of resource, ensure that holding for drilling well cause Supervention exhibition.
